Circulene

Circulene, also called Corannulenes are aromatic hydrocarbons. The structuring member of Circulene is that the cyclic aromatics in turn form a cyclic compound. Circulene may be composed of both aromatics and heteroaromatics from.

Nomenclature for easier Circulene the number of aromatic rings is prefixed in brackets. That is the systematic name of corannulene circulene, coronene - circulene.

Construction

Circulene divided into an inner and an outer perimeter. Both perimeter form durchkonjugierte systems, depending on the number of electrons that can have both aromatic and antiaromatic character.

The coupling between the two parameters depend on the system under consideration. Possible is a strong coupling between the two perimeters, which corresponds to the main resonance within each of aromatics and a weak coupling which corresponds to the presence of a separate inner and outer aromatic system.
